AI Automation Best Practices for 2026

Automation is shifting from task-level scripts to cross-functional AI workflows. These practices help teams move from pilot to production without creating fragile dependencies.

1. Start with process discovery

Use process mining and workflow analytics to identify highest-impact automation candidates before building. Teams that start with discovery reduce rework by 40%.

2. Design for human handoffs

Automation should handle routine work and escalate exceptions clearly. Define ownership, SLAs, and review loops so AI-assisted workflows stay accountable.

2. Measure automation ROI

Track throughput, error rate, handling time, and cost per transaction. Set baselines before automation and review them quarterly.

3. Secure data and access

Apply least-privilege access, audit logs, and data classification to automation pipelines. Treat model inputs and outputs as sensitive by default.

4. Automate incrementally

Launch narrow automation, validate outcomes, then expand scope. Small rollouts produce faster feedback and lower risk than broad launches.
